Choosing between silk screen printing and DTG printing services for team uniforms requires understanding the strengths and limitations of each method. This guide breaks down both options for sports teams, organizations, and group orders in 2026.
What Is Silk Screen Printing?
Silk screen printing uses stencils and mesh screens to apply ink directly onto fabric. Each color requires a separate screen. The ink sits on top of the fabric, creating bold, opaque designs.
This method has been the industry standard for custom apparel printing for decades.

Key characteristics of silk screen printing:
Uses thick, plastisol or water-based inks
Requires setup time for each screen
Works on cotton, polyester, nylon, and synthetic blends
Produces vibrant, solid colors
Best for designs with fewer colors
What Is DTG Printing?
DTG (Direct to Garment) printing works like a large inkjet printer. It sprays water-based ink directly into the fabric fibers. No screens or stencils required.
DTG printing services have improved significantly in recent years. The technology handles complex, multi-color designs with ease.

Key characteristics of DTG printing:
Uses water-based inks that absorb into fabric
No setup fees or screen creation
Works best on 100% cotton
Handles unlimited colors per design
Ideal for photographic or detailed artwork
Durability Comparison for Team Uniforms
Team uniforms take a beating. Practice sessions, games, and frequent washing demand prints that last.
Silk Screen Printing Durability:
Properly cured prints survive 100+ washes with no fade
Thick ink layers resist wear from heavy use
Maintains color vibrancy through repeated washing
Recommended for workwear and athletic uniforms
DTG Printing Durability:
Typical prints rated for approximately 20 washes before degradation
Thinner ink application fades faster
Better suited for casual wear and promotional items
Requires proper care to extend lifespan
Winner for team uniforms: Silk screen printing.
Cost Analysis for Team Orders
Budget matters for every team and organization. Understanding the cost structure of each method helps with planning.
Silk Screen Printing Costs:
Higher upfront setup costs (screen creation)
Cost per item drops significantly after setup
Most cost-effective for orders of 50+ items
Bulk discounts increase with larger quantities
Reorders using existing screens reduce future costs
DTG Printing Costs:
No setup fees
Consistent per-item pricing regardless of quantity
Higher ink costs for large batches
Better value for small orders (1-25 items)
Each print costs the same whether first or fiftieth
Cost breakdown by order size:
Order Size | Most Cost-Effective Method |
1-10 items | DTG printing |
11-25 items | DTG printing (usually) |
26-49 items | Depends on design complexity |
50+ items | Silk screen printing |
100+ items | Silk screen printing |
Fabric Compatibility for Athletic Wear
Team uniforms often use performance fabrics. Not all printing methods work equally well on all materials.
Silk Screen Printing Fabric Options:
Cotton
Polyester
Nylon
Synthetic blends
Performance materials
Moisture-wicking fabrics
No pre-treatment required. Produces high-opacity prints on dark materials without additional processing.
DTG Printing Fabric Options:
100% cotton (optimal)
Cotton-polyester blends (50/50 or higher cotton content)
Requires pre-treatment for dark garments
Limited effectiveness on synthetic materials
Not recommended for pure polyester athletic wear
Winner for athletic uniforms: Silk screen printing.

Design Considerations
The complexity of your team logo or design influences which method works best.
Best for Silk Screen Printing:
Simple designs with 1-6 colors
Bold logos and text
Team names and numbers
Solid color graphics
High contrast designs
Best for DTG Printing:
Photographic images
Designs with gradients
Unlimited color palettes
Detailed artwork
Small text or fine lines
Most team uniforms feature simple designs with fewer colors. Logos, team names, and graphics typically fall within the 1-6 color range. This makes silk screen printing the natural fit for standard team uniform orders.

Which Method Should Your Team Choose?
Choose silk screen printing if:
Ordering 50+ uniforms
Using polyester or synthetic athletic fabrics
Design has 6 or fewer colors
Durability is a priority
Budget requires lowest per-item cost
Choose DTG printing if:
Ordering fewer than 25 items
Using 100% cotton garments
Design includes photos or many colors
Need single items or samples first
Rush order with no time for screen setup
The Verdict for 2026
Silk screen printing remains the better choice for team uniforms in 2026. The combination of superior durability, cost-effectiveness for bulk orders, and compatibility with athletic fabrics makes it the clear winner for most team and organization orders.
DTG printing services fill a valuable role for small quantity orders, sample production, and designs that require unlimited colors. Teams ordering personalized items for individual players may benefit from DTG flexibility.
Both methods have their place in custom apparel printing. The right choice depends on your specific order size, fabric requirements, and budget.
